We are a software product company specializing in cutting-edge Augmented Reality (AR) and Artificial Intelligence (AI) solutions. We thrive on innovation and are looking for a highly skilled and proactive Senior Java Developer to join our dynamic team.
As a Senior Java Developer, you will be responsible for designing, developing, and deploying scalable backend solutions and services using Java, Spring Boot, and Microservices architecture. You will collaborate closely with cross-functional teams to deliver high-quality software solutions while ensuring best practices in coding, testing, and deployment.
Key Responsibilities
-
Design, develop, and maintain Java-based applications
-
Write clean, maintainable, and efficient code
-
Participate in code reviews and mentor junior developers
-
Collaborate with cross-functional teams to define and implement new features
-
Troubleshoot and resolve complex technical issues
-
Contribute to architectural decisions and technical documentation
-
Ensure application performance, quality, and responsiveness